Maddon’s Cubs covet sweep of Pirates
Over the weekend, Jason Hammel had his shortest outing of the season. Yet Cubs manager Joe Maddon is more than ready for the veteran hurler to tackle tonight’s series finale with the Pirates.
The two NL Central rivals square off at 8:05 p.m. ET, with oddsmakers leaning toward the hosts. Online sports book BetDSI lists the North Siders as 1.5-run favorites, while Pittsburgh represents a +140 underdog. The over/under run figure sits at 8.5.
Chicago wants to pull off a sweep, but Hammel (13-7, 3.21 ERA) must figure out a way to bounce back from Saturday’s gaffe on the West Coast. He was lifted after 2 1/3 innings, having surrendered three runs and five hits to the Dodgers. Maddon, though, specifically moved the South Carolina product up in the rotation to assume this evening’s assignment.
Clint Hurdle counters with Ryan Vogelsong (3-3, 3.02), who continues to enjoy a renaissance in the Steel City. The righty holds a 2-2 record with a 2.48 ERA in August. He’s gone 5-7 in 20 career meetings with the Cubbies.

Maddon’s troops boast an 11-3 mark against the Buccos in 2016. Still, the visitors desperately need to salvage a contest vs. the majors’ top team before welcoming lowly Milwaukee to the Rust Belt region. Hammel’s recent struggles provide the perfect opportunity to do just that.
